Diwali celebration with Indian students organized in Melbourne

 

the Consulate General of India in Melbourne, together with Study Melbourne and City of Melbourne, organized Diwali celebration at The Couch International Student Centre. Besides dance, music and delicious cuisine, the evening provided an opportunity for student orientation and networking.
Consul General Dr. Sushil Kumar; Director, Study Melbourne Caroline Hartnett; General Manager, City of Melbourne Rick Kwasek; Commanding Officer, Salvation Army, Melbourne Major Brendan Nottle; CEO, Manhari Metals Maddy Gupta, and Chairman, Confederation of Indian Industry-Indian Business Forum Ashok Mysore addressed the students and interacted with them.
Manhari Metals , Student Ambassadors & volunteers supported the event to make the evening enjoyable.
